Song available on iTunes here: https://geo.itunes.apple.com/us/album/welcome-to-my-house-single/id1165527565?app=itunes More on the story here: http://www.lucandthelovingtons.com And here: http://www.votchildren.org/welcome-to-my-house.html “Welcome to My House”, a collaboration between non profit Voices of the Children and band Luc and the Lovingtons, features American teens and Syrian refugee youth singing a cross-cultural message of joy, love and peace. The video was filmed on site at the Za’atari Refugee Camp and Wadi Rum in Jordan as well as in the Skagit Valley of Washington State, USA.  Most of the youth, participants and locations featured in the video were apart of a greater on-going program created by Voices of the Children which provides free arts classes and cross cultural collaborations between Syrian and American teens. This organization's powerful work can be seen here: http://www.votchildren.org Luc and the Lovingtons, who travelled to the Za'atari Refugee Camp as teaching artists for Voices of the Children, provided art and song writing courses to Syrian youth. The band also has an ongoing humanitarian tour called The Goodness Tour: Music and Art for People Facing Adversity.
